System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技术实现步骤摘要】
本申请涉及终端领域,并且更具体地,涉及一种投屏方法、投屏系统和电子设备。
技术介绍
1、随着互联网的普及和发展,投屏技术得到了广泛的应用,投屏是指将一个设备上的媒体文件投放到另一个设备上进行播放。例如,用户可以利用手机中的投屏应用将视频资源投放到智能电视中,进而用户可以利用智能电视观看手机中的视频。然而,在投屏过程中,手机可能会随着用户的移动发生移动,投屏的环境可能会发生变化,从而可能会影响投屏效果,影响用户体验感。
技术实现思路
1、本申请实施例提供一种投屏方法、投屏系统和电子设备,目的在于在投屏过程中可以调整投屏方式,从而可以保持较好地投屏效果和较佳地投屏体验感。
2、第一方面,提供了一种投屏方法,该方法应用于第一电子设备,该方法包括:响应于用户的操作,将投屏数据投屏到第二电子设备上;在第三电子设备的投屏效果优于所述第二电子设备的投屏效果的情况下,将所述投屏数据从所述第二电子设备切换投屏到所述第三电子设备上,所述第三电子设备和所述第一电子设备具有相同的账号信息,所述投屏效果根据网络环境质量、蓝牙信号质量、投屏业务和投屏参数确定。
3、其中,第一电子设备为投屏源设备,第二电子设备和/或第三电子设备为投屏目标设备。
4、需要说明的是,第三电子设备的投屏效果是根据第三电子设备与第一电子设备之间的网络环境质量、第三电子设备与第一电子设备之间的蓝牙信号质量、投屏业务和投屏参数确定的;第二电子设备的投屏效果是根据第二电子设备与第一电子设备之间的网络环境质
5、可选地,投屏业务包括但不限于以下业务:桌面投屏业务、音频投屏业务、视频投屏业务、文件投屏业务。
6、可选地,投屏参数包括但不限于以下参数:投屏目标设备支持的显示方式、投屏目标设备的分辨率,其中,投屏目标设备支持的显示方式例如可以包括横屏显示方式和/或竖屏显示方式。
7、在一种可能的实现方式中,将所述投屏数据从所述第二电子设备切换投屏到所述第三电子设备上可以理解为:第一电子设备不再向第二电子设备发送投屏数据,而将投屏数据发送给第三电子设备。
8、在本实施例中,第一电子设备在向第二电子设备投屏过程中可以检测投屏过程中的投屏效果,若检测到第三电子设备的投屏效果优于第二电子设备的投屏效果,则第一电子设备可以调整投屏方式(例如,切换投屏目标设备),将投屏数据投屏到投屏效果更好的第三电子设备上,从而可以保持较好地投屏效果和较佳地投屏体验感。
9、在一种可能的实现方式中,该投屏方法可以包括:响应于用户的操作,将投屏数据投屏到第二电子设备上;获取第一信息,第一信息用于指示所述第二电子设备的投屏参数信息;获取第二信息,第二信息用于指示第三电子设备的投屏参数信息;根据所述第一信息和所述第二信息,将所述投屏数据从所述第二电子设备切换投屏到所述第三电子设备上,所述第三电子设备和所述第一电子设备具有相同的账号信息。
10、可选地,所述根据所述第一信息和所述第二信息,将所述投屏数据从所述第二电子设备切换投屏到所述第三电子设备上,包括:在所述第二信息优于所述第一信息的情况下,将所述投屏数据从所述第二电子设备切换投屏到所述第三电子设备上。
11、在一些实施例中,在第三电子设备的网络环境质量优于所述第二电子设备的网络环境质量的情况下,将所述投屏数据从所述第二电子设备切换投屏到所述第三电子设备上。
12、在一些实施例中,在第三电子设备的蓝牙信号质量优于所述第二电子设备的蓝牙信号质量的情况下,将所述投屏数据从所述第二电子设备切换投屏到所述第三电子设备上。
13、在一些实施例中,在第三电子设备的投屏参数优于所述第二电子设备的投屏参数的情况下,将所述投屏数据从所述第二电子设备切换投屏到所述第三电子设备上。
14、在一些实施例中,在第三电子设备的网络环境质量优于所述第二电子设备的网络环境质量,且第三电子设备的蓝牙信号质量优于所述第二电子设备的蓝牙信号质量的情况下,将所述投屏数据从所述第二电子设备切换投屏到所述第三电子设备上。
15、在一些实施例中,在第三电子设备的网络环境质量优于所述第二电子设备的网络环境质量,且第三电子设备的投屏参数优于所述第二电子设备的投屏参数的情况下,将所述投屏数据从所述第二电子设备切换投屏到所述第三电子设备上。
16、在一些实施例中,在第三电子设备的蓝牙信号质量优于所述第二电子设备的蓝牙信号质量,且第三电子设备的投屏参数优于所述第二电子设备的投屏参数的情况下,将所述投屏数据从所述第二电子设备切换投屏到所述第三电子设备上。
17、在一些实施例中,在第三电子设备的网络环境质量优于所述第二电子设备的网络环境质量,但第三电子设备的蓝牙信号质量劣于所述第二电子设备的蓝牙信号质量的情况下,将所述投屏数据从所述第二电子设备切换投屏到所述第三电子设备上。
18、在一些实施例中,在第三电子设备的网络环境质量优于所述第二电子设备的网络环境质量,但第三电子设备的投屏参数劣于所述第二电子设备的投屏参数的情况下,将所述投屏数据从所述第二电子设备切换投屏到所述第三电子设备上。
19、可以理解的是,第一电子设备在切换投屏目标设备时,还考虑了投屏业务,通过对网络环境质量、蓝牙信号质量、投屏业务和投屏参数的综合考虑,确定是否需要切换投屏目标设备。
20、在一些实施例中,若投屏业务为视频投屏,视频投屏对网络环境质量和投屏参数的要求较高,因此,在第三电子设备的网络环境质量优于所述第二电子设备的网络环境质量的情况下,和/或,在第三电子设备的投屏参数优于所述第二电子设备的投屏参数的情况下,将所述投屏数据从所述第二电子设备切换投屏到所述第三电子设备上。
21、在一些实施例中,若投屏业务为音频投屏,音频投屏可以采用蓝牙投屏协议进行投屏,此时,对于蓝牙信号质量的要求较高,因此,在一些实施例中,在第三电子设备的蓝牙信号质量优于所述第二电子设备的蓝牙信号质量的情况下,将所述投屏数据从所述第二电子设备切换投屏到所述第三电子设备上。
22、结合第一方面,在第一方面的某些实现方式中,在将投屏数据投屏到第二电子设备上之前,所述方法还包括:响应于用户的操作,向所述第二电子设备发送配对协商数据,所述配对协商数据包括第一配对参数;发送广播报文,所述广播报文携带所述第一电子设备的投屏参数信息;接收所述第二电子设备返回的响应报文,所述第二电子设备返回的响应报文包括第二配对参数,所述第二配对参数是所述第二电子设备根据所述配对协商数据得到的,所述第二配对参数与所述第一配对参数具有对应关系;根据所述第一配对参数和所述第二配对参数,识别所述第二电子设备。
23、可选地,配对协商数据可以包括但不限于以下内容:厂商标识符、软件版本本文档来自技高网...
【技术保护点】
1.一种投屏方法,其特征在于,所述方法应用于第一电子设备,所述方法包括:
2.根据权利要求1所述的方法,其特征在于,在将投屏数据投屏到第二电子设备上之前,所述方法还包括:
3.根据权利要求2所述的方法,其特征在于,所述将投屏数据投屏到第二电子设备上,包括:
4.根据权利要求3所述的方法,其特征在于,所述根据所述目标投屏方式,将所述投屏数据投屏到所述第二电子设备上,包括:
5.根据权利要求2至4中任一项所述的方法,其特征在于,所述接收第二电子设备返回的响应报文包括:
6.根据权利要求5所述的方法,其特征在于,所述对所述满足预设条件的电子设备进行排序,生成目标设备管理列表,包括:
7.根据权利要求5或6所述的方法,其特征在于,所述方法还包括:
8.根据权利要求2至7中任一项所述的方法,其特征在于,所述第一电子设备上设置有第一控件,所述第一控件包括投屏业务选项,所述投屏业务包括以下至少一项:桌面投屏业务、音频投屏业务、视频投屏业务和文件投屏业务,
9.根据权利要求2至8中任一项所述的方法,其
10.一种投屏系统,其特征在于,所述系统包括第一电子设备、第二电子设备和第三电子设备,其中,
11.根据权利要求10所述的投屏系统,其特征在于,
12.根据权利要求11所述的投屏系统,其特征在于,所述第一电子设备还用于:
13.根据权利要求12所述的投屏系统,其特征在于,所述第一电子设备还用于:
14.根据权利要求11至13中任一项所述的投屏系统,其特征在于,所述第一电子设备还用于:
15.根据权利要求14所述的投屏系统,其特征在于,所述第一电子设备还用于:
16.根据权利要求14或15所述的投屏系统,其特征在于,所述第一电子设备还用于:
17.根据权利要求11至16中任一项所述的投屏系统,其特征在于,所述第一电子设备上设置有第一控件,所述第一控件包括投屏业务选项,所述投屏业务包括以下至少一项:桌面投屏业务、音频投屏业务、视频投屏业务和文件投屏业务,
18.根据权利要求11至17中任一项所述的投屏系统,其特征在于,所述第一电子设备还用于:
19.一种电子设备,其特征在于,包括:
20.一种计算机可读存储介质,其特征在于,包括计算机指令,当所述计算机指令在电子设备上运行时,使得所述电子设备执行如权利要求1至9中任一项所述的投屏方法。
...【技术特征摘要】
1.一种投屏方法,其特征在于,所述方法应用于第一电子设备,所述方法包括:
2.根据权利要求1所述的方法,其特征在于,在将投屏数据投屏到第二电子设备上之前,所述方法还包括:
3.根据权利要求2所述的方法,其特征在于,所述将投屏数据投屏到第二电子设备上,包括:
4.根据权利要求3所述的方法,其特征在于,所述根据所述目标投屏方式,将所述投屏数据投屏到所述第二电子设备上,包括:
5.根据权利要求2至4中任一项所述的方法,其特征在于,所述接收第二电子设备返回的响应报文包括:
6.根据权利要求5所述的方法,其特征在于,所述对所述满足预设条件的电子设备进行排序,生成目标设备管理列表,包括:
7.根据权利要求5或6所述的方法,其特征在于,所述方法还包括:
8.根据权利要求2至7中任一项所述的方法,其特征在于,所述第一电子设备上设置有第一控件,所述第一控件包括投屏业务选项,所述投屏业务包括以下至少一项:桌面投屏业务、音频投屏业务、视频投屏业务和文件投屏业务,
9.根据权利要求2至8中任一项所述的方法,其特征在于,所述向第二电子设备发送配对协商数据包括:
10.一种投屏系统,其特征在于,所述系统包括第一电子设...
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。